Output 68ed7f3629d7c9618cc6da21a8ac12ee91691c0226a7520a72f6a3136a0d7bb6:0

value
176786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d951ea105f5d52359bf92e37c0abc9c2b84c378f OP_EQUAL
address
3MW6ggECXfQXhLvFJor9sfPG4oeMktp7s5
transaction
68ed7f3629d7c9618cc6da21a8ac12ee91691c0226a7520a72f6a3136a0d7bb6